Текущее время: 04 май 2025, 02:13 • Часовой пояс: UTC + 3 часа |
Поддержка всех тюнеров Beholder в Linux
Автор | Сообщение |
NordWest
|
|
Зарегистрирован: 14 апр 2007, 17:40 Сообщения: 13
|
Здравствуйте.
Перешел с ядра 2.6.18 на 2.6.25. В tvtime вместо dafault появился television. Но каналов нет. Сканирование не находит ни в PAL ни в SECAM. Что же делать? Я все эти пляски с modprobe не очень понимаю. Объясните плз!
WindowsXP SP2
Behold TV 507 RDS
BeholdTV 5.10
BDA драйвер 5.1.3.0
|
|
|
Linux
|
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
NordWest писал(а): Перешел с ядра 2.6.18 на 2.6.25. В tvtime вместо dafault появился television. Но каналов нет. Сканирование не находит ни в PAL ни в SECAM.
Скорей всего дело в отсутствии параметра secam=d при загрузке модуля saa7134.
1. Выгрузить модуль saa7134
rmmod saa7134
2. Загрузить модуль с опцией
modprobe saa7134 secam=d
3. Проверить работу. Если все заработает установить этот параметр в файлы конфигурации загрузки модулей.
|
|
|
NordWest
|
Добавлено: 17 сен 2008, 07:08. Заголовок сообщения: |
|
|
Зарегистрирован: 14 апр 2007, 17:40 Сообщения: 13
|
После перезагрузки ситуация слегка изменилась. Описал в отдельной теме http://www.beholder.ru/bb/viewtopic.php?t=7129
Цитата: 3. Проверить работу. Если все заработает установить этот параметр в файлы конфигурации загрузки модулей.
Вот у меня Debian, где ти файлы? Посмотрел файлы, описаные тут http://www.debian.org/doc/manuals/refer ... #s-modules , но у меня нет /etc/modules.conf, например. Хотя там же файл modules со строчкой loop.
WindowsXP SP2
Behold TV 507 RDS
BeholdTV 5.10
BDA драйвер 5.1.3.0
|
|
|
Linux
|
Добавлено: 17 сен 2008, 07:59. Заголовок сообщения: |
|
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
Предлагаю попробовать сначала с консоли. Потом можно прописать в тот файл где loop.
|
|
|
madcore
|
Добавлено: 18 сен 2008, 18:43. Заголовок сообщения: |
|
|
Зарегистрирован: 07 июл 2008, 08:23 Сообщения: 14
|
2Suррort:
По ходу в последних дровах поломали поддержку пульта где-то в saa7134-i2c.. Функция saa7134_set_i2c_ir из saa7134-input.c не вызывается, дальше пока не смотрел. В дефолтных из 2.6.25 пульт работает, но нет мпег-кодера.
Или это только у меня так?
Beholder M6 Extra
M6 extra / Gentoo
|
|
|
Linux
|
Добавлено: 19 сен 2008, 01:56. Заголовок сообщения: |
|
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
madcore писал(а): По ходу в последних дровах поломали поддержку пульта где-то в saa7134-i2c..
Проверю отпишу. Какое ядро и video4linux?
|
|
|
madcore
|
Добавлено: 19 сен 2008, 07:58. Заголовок сообщения: |
|
|
Зарегистрирован: 07 июл 2008, 08:23 Сообщения: 14
|
Ядро 2.6.25.* из OpenSUSE 11.0, video4linux - последний снапшот http://linuxtv.org/hg/v4l-dvb/archive/tip.tar.bz2. Когда точно поломалось не знаю, в снапшоте от 3го сентября уже пульта не было, перед этим качал в июле - там был.
M6 extra / Gentoo
|
|
|
Linux
|
Добавлено: 22 сен 2008, 09:54. Заголовок сообщения: |
Сломали |
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
Подтверждаю, работу пультов через I2C в новых тюнерах серии М6 и H6 сломали. Разбираюсь с проблемой.
|
|
|
Linux
|
Добавлено: 24 сен 2008, 07:04. Заголовок сообщения: |
|
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
Нашел в чем дело. 17 августа майнтейнеры video4linux отвязали зависимость модуля saa7134 от модуля ir-kbd-i2c через который работает пульт. Проблему с отвязкой решаем.
Быстрое решение, чтобы заработал пульт, надо загрузить вручную модуль ir-kbd-i2c и прописать его загрузку при поднятии Linux.
|
|
|
madcore
|
Добавлено: 25 сен 2008, 21:12. Заголовок сообщения: |
|
|
Зарегистрирован: 07 июл 2008, 08:23 Сообщения: 14
|
Да, с модулем ir-kbd-i2c пульт работает, спасибо.
M6 extra / Gentoo
|
|
|
Иван Иванов
|
Добавлено: 27 сен 2008, 18:15. Заголовок сообщения: |
|
|
Зарегистрирован: 20 июл 2007, 18:34 Сообщения: 29 Откуда: Край вечной мерзлоты
|
В какое ядро будет включена эта доработка? Сразу пустят? Хочется просто тупо собрать новое ядро. Хотя и невнапряг подключить свежий v4l2 пак.
Update: подключил... Радио заиграло! Урра! Но запись чего-то через cat /dev/video1 не идет.. пишется пустой черный файл. Скрипт параметры все устанавливает, канал переключает. Но блин... Не пишет. Просто черные, пустые кадры. При включении записи - появляются помехи на просмотре в виде мерцания светлосерым и искажения цветопередачи. Откуда какую информацию надо вам выдернуть?
Блин.. SECAM-DK - стал вообще 17, все дальше и дальше толкают, каждый раз - по-разному.
Вот картинки искажений при включении скрипта:
http://img142.imageshack.us/my.php?imag ... er1ml1.png
http://img137.imageshack.us/my.php?imag ... er2if3.png
Ubuntu Linux 20.04 (Linux 3.2.0-22-generic-pae #35-Ubuntu SMP), Beholder M6 Extra in MPlayer with remote controller
Последний раз редактировалось Иван Иванов 28 сен 2008, 20:06, всего редактировалось 2 раз(а).
|
|
|
madcore
|
Добавлено: 28 сен 2008, 11:18. Заголовок сообщения: |
|
|
Зарегистрирован: 07 июл 2008, 08:23 Сообщения: 14
|
Иван Иванов писал(а): Но запись чего-то через cat /dev/video0 не идет.. пишется пустой черный файл.
mpeg-кодер живет в /dev/video1
M6 extra / Gentoo
|
|
|
Linux
|
Добавлено: 28 сен 2008, 13:23. Заголовок сообщения: |
|
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
madcor написал все правильно, сжатый поток надо брать с /dev/video1
|
|
|
lexan712
|
Добавлено: 29 сен 2008, 13:53. Заголовок сообщения: |
|
|
Зарегистрирован: 29 сен 2008, 13:47 Сообщения: 25
|
Я новичек в линуксе стоит Mandriva 2008 strip после маке выдается сообщение make -C /v4l-dvb/v4l
make[1]: Entering directory `/v4l-dvb/v4l'
No version yet, using 2.6.24.4-laptop-1mnb
make[1]: Leaving directory `/v4l-dvb/v4l'
make[1]: Entering directory `/v4l-dvb/v4l'
Updating/Creating .config
./scripts/make_kconfig.pl /lib/modules/2.6.24.4-laptop-1mnb/build /lib/modules/2.6.24.4-laptop-1mnb/build
Preparing to compile for kernel version 2.6.24
File not found: /lib/modules/2.6.24.4-laptop-1mnb/build/.config at ./scripts/make_kconfig.pl line 32, <IN> line 4.
make[1]: *** Нет правила для сборки цели `.myconfig', требуемой для `config-compat.h'. Останов.
make[1]: Leaving directory `/v4l-dvb/v4l'
make: *** [all] Ошибка 2
и как с этим боротся?
|
|
|
Linux
|
Добавлено: 30 сен 2008, 07:38. Заголовок сообщения: |
|
|
Beholder |  |
Зарегистрирован: 19 авг 2004, 11:51 Сообщения: 396
|
Цитата: make: *** [all] Ошибка 2 и как с этим боротся?
Надо как минимум почитать эту ветку. Такая ошибка здесь описывалась и как с ней бороться тоже.
Исправления регрессии пульта для семейства M6 вошли в основную ветку.
Mon Sep 29 05:25:40 2008
Когда изменения video4linux будут влиты в ядро знает только... Линукс Торвальдс, ждем. Новости будут, напишу сразу.
|
|
|
Кто сейчас на конференции |
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0 |
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ения
|
|